Output f0786b3c153c22fddcfb402473c48a9a807d43e556d617c449d5655e2ed87b7c:87

value
971149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5000d69cd6e4aa604e1b47e30cf81028186426c8 OP_EQUAL
address
38z2z8yusdt4sSHN1wNFjEde1Ppr6hcQha
transaction
f0786b3c153c22fddcfb402473c48a9a807d43e556d617c449d5655e2ed87b7c
confirmations
168293
spent
true